Factors Influencing Cost
Slate roof construction in Middlesex County, MA, involves the installation of durable and aesthetically appealing slate tiles. This type of roofing is known for its longevity and classic appearance, often chosen for historic or high-end properties. Understanding typical project considerations can help in planning and comparing options for slate roof installations or repairs.
- Materials: Natural slate tiles are commonly used, with options varying in thickness, color, and quality to match architectural styles.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small repairs to complete roof replacements, often covering standard residential roof areas or larger commercial structures.
- Labor Complexity: Installation requires skilled craftsmanship due to the weight and precise placement of slate tiles, which can influence labor costs and duration.
- Permitting: Local building permits are typically required in Middlesex County, especially for new constructions or extensive roof replacements, to ensure code compliance.
- Extras: Additional considerations may include underlayment, flashing, ridge caps, and potential reinforcement for existing structures to support slate weight.
